Charmaine Crooks, C.M is a 5 time Olympian, Silver Medalist and a recognized business, sport and award winning community leader.

She has been a Corporate Director on several private and public boards in a variety of sectors including technology, finance, real estate, health and entertainment for over 25 years.  The CEO of a global consultancy firm, she provides strategic advisory, marketing and corporate development services to a variety of sectors.

Her many awards and recognitions include Member of the Order of Canada, BC Sports Hall of Fame, UTEP Sports Hall of Fame, Canadian Athletics Hall of Fame. She was awarded the Women And Sport Trophy by the International Olympic Committee and has been recognized as a WXN top 100 women

Charmaine is a founding member and past member of the International Board of Directors for Right To Play, an athlete-driven international humanitarian organization that uses sports to encourage the development of youth in disadvantaged areas. She was the first female and person of colour elected to be President of Soccer Canada. And she is currently on the Organizing Committee for FIFA Competitions.

Her many volunteer leadership roles include the Canadian Olympic foundation, Canucks Autism network and Big Sisters.  She was also a long standing member of the Canadian Olympic Committee and the first female and person of colour elected to be President of Soccer Canada. She is a founding member of the Black Opportunity fund.

Charmaine co-founded the 365 International Sport Foundation, dedicated to bringing communities together through sport. This includes the creation of Our City ride, a mass participation sport for all cycling ride & Festival.

As one of the board members of the 2010 Olympic Winter and Paralympic Winter Games (Vanoc), Charmaine was the only director to serve from the initial bid phase through to the successful end of the Games. At the Atlanta Centennial Olympic Games where she was Team Canada Opening Ceremony flagbearer and she was part of the first group of active Athletes elected by peers to the International Olympic Committee as voting members. There she served on the IOC Press Commission, IOC Culture and Education Commission, New Media working group, IOC 2000 Reform Commission, founding IOC Ethics Commission and the founding World Anti-Doping Agency.

Globally, Charmaine is a Champion for Peace with Peace and Sport.
